CuttersMate Mini - Product Overview - See It In Action!
In this video, James goes over what comes with your purchase of the CuttersMate Mini and shows how precise this cutter can be.
The fixed arm allows the cutting head to stay perpendicular to the glass you're cutting allowing clean and precise cuts. You can use this cutter standing or sitting and it's equipped with a weighted handle so you only need minimal pressure to score your glass.

Creator's Bottle Turner Deluxe Kit - Made in the USA - Electric 30 RPM
Переглядів 684Рік тому
Creator's Bottle Turner Deluxe Kit - Made in the USA - Creatorsbrand.com Plug and Play No Assembly Required The Creator's Bottle Turner was designed to eliminate having to manually rotate scored bottles while using a candle or heat gun. After your bottle is scored, simply slip your Bottle Holder Assembly into the neck of the bottle. Using the included Roller Base, place the end of the bottle so...
Creator's Circle Pro 12 Glass Cutter- Made in the USA! Scores Diameters from 3/8" to 12"
Переглядів 8402 роки тому
Creator's Circle Pro 12 is available to purchase from our online store at Creatorsbrand.com Cutting Circles Couldn't Be Easier! Cutting perfect circles are no problem with the Circle Pro 12. Score circles from 3/8" to 12" with precision and ease. It includes detailed instructions with step-by-step photos. Convenient for your workshop - it sets up in seconds and folds down for storage.
